Former Role in Roseville Big Band: 

Lead and third trumpet; Peter also doubles on flugelhorn.

Member during: 

2001 and 2002

Occupation: 

Computer consultant

In addition to subbing in the Roseville Big Band, Peter plays trumpet in the Swing Beat big band, the Good News Big Band, and the Plymouth Community Concert Band. He also does freelance jazz and commercial work in the Twin Cities area, playing trumpet, piccolo trumpet, and flugelhorn.

From 1975 through 1987, while he was earning his music education degree from Northwestern University and in the next decade afterward, Peter played in commercial, Latin, and jazz bands in the Chicago area.

He also has done some horn section arranging for a local corporate rhythm and blues band.
